If your patio doors aren't sliding smoothly or latching properly, it might be a sign that they're not in alignment. This isn't a hard problem to solve and can be done with a bit of DIY.

A sliding door is a pretty simple device The frame slides into tracks at the top and bottom. Rollers on either side help the door slide smoothly. If your sliding patio doors are not sliding smoothly, it's likely that one or more of these rollers has become misaligned. Fortunately, re-aligning these rollers isn't a Herculean task that can be done with just a few tools.

It is important that you begin the adjustment with the door open fully, allowing for complete visibility and access to your latch mechanism. Locate the adjustment screw over or around the latch and loosen it slightly so you can rotate your latch to align with the strike plate. It could take a few attempts to get the lock in the right position. Don't be reluctant to apply some pressure to ensure that it is securely in place.

After you've made your adjustments, test the door. Check to see if it latches and slides correctly. Repeat the steps to adjust the latch if it doesn't. Close the keeper screw to secure the strikeplate in its correct location.

A sliding door that is stuck

Door tracks that slide can be clogged with dirt and dust, which can make them difficult to slide. This can be due to a number of reasons, such as dusty rollers and dirt in the track. It is essential to clean and lubricate your doors regularly particularly when you use them frequently.

Start by cleaning the tracks. You can then clean the aluminium door panels themselves to remove any dirt and debris. Apply the lubricant in a thin layer on the tracks and door rollers. A silicon-based spray-lubricant works best, but you can also try WD-40 or another household product. Avoid overspraying because it can cause the surface to become slippery.

If your sliding doors continue squeaking or difficult to slide, you might have to replace the rollers. Over time, they may be damaged by corrosion or rust. When you replace the rollers your door should be smooth again.

A sliding door can be snagged or stuck when you attempt to move it. This is caused by thermal contraction or expansion, which can cause door sashes and frames to become tighter. You can fix this by adjusting the dimensions of the door sashes or by using a silicon-based grease.

Sliding doors depend on acrylic or steel rollers, which are housed in the lower aluminium door panel. These rollers have a curved bottom to help them grip the track. The rollers may be worn out in time, or might be damaged by dirt, rust, or corrosion. The wheels could break when you apply too excessive force on the door.

To avoid these issues To avoid these issues, you must regularly clean the track and grease the rollers. Also, you should ensure that the door sashes are correctly aligned with the frame.
